Abstract

The invention relates to the technical field of aerospace Hall electric propulsion, in particular to an iodine medium ground gas supply device for a Hall thruster and a using method. The iodine mediumground gas supply device includes an iodine vapor generating unit and an iodine vapor flow control unit, wherein the iodine vapor generating unit includes a solid iodine storage tank and a first pressure sensor. The iodine vapor flow control unit includes a shut-off valve, a pressure relief valve, a second pressure sensor and a flow control valve. The iodine medium ground gas supply device for the Hall thruster adopts an iodine medium propellant to achieve good thrust parameter performance, and the thruster is more efficient. An iodine medium is heated and sublimated into iodine vapor for transportation, the condensation of the iodine vapor in the transportation process is prevented, the flow rate of the iodine vapor can be controlled in real time, and it is ensured that the iodine vaporcan be stably and accurately transported to the Hall thruster.

technical field [0001] The application relates to the technical field of aerospace Hall electric propulsion, in particular to an iodine medium ground gas supply device for a Hall thruster and a method for using it. Background technique [0002] With the development of aerospace technology and the continuous maturity of electric propulsion technology, more and more electric thrusters are being developed and developed by the aerospace industry of various countries. Compared with traditional chemical thrusters, electric thrusters have the characteristics of high specific impulse, long life, compact structure, and small size, and have significant application prospects in satellite attitude control, orbit correction, orbit maintenance, and power compensation. [0003] Among many electric thrusters, the Hall thruster has attracted widespread attention because of its simple structure, easy operation, and high utilization of working fluid.
